STCW Course in Kenya | Cruise Ship & Maritime Jobs

The maritime industry is one of the largest employers globally, offering rewarding careers on cruise ships, cargo vessels, tankers, offshore platforms, and luxury yachts. If you want to work at sea, the most important qualification you need is STCW certification. What is STCW Certification?
